Police are searching for six individuals they say took an out-of-service subway train for a joyride on Saturday night.

According to authorities, the group gained access to the locked R train at the 36th Street and 4th Avenue subway station. Authorities believe they used transit keys to get in.

The exact duration and distance of the joyride is unknown, but transit authorities are analyzing the train's black box data to get more information.

MTA Chair and CEO Janno Lieber is outraged by the incident, calling for accountability after the dangerous stunt.
